Transaction c515c9156106c89c678e477441933af4f17fa12dcf00ccf2108147c5d0545d0e
1 Input
1 Output
-
c515c9156106c89c678e477441933af4f17fa12dcf00ccf2108147c5d0545d0e:0
- value
- 143477
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c379374b575866de0462466c6c513eaababb2d6 OP_EQUAL
- address
- 34GDRQLTgUa1EqdaoqwDToAbkUbDkR6hTR